I sanded my carbon fiber lip down with some a 80 grit and I'm on my second coat of epoxy after applying it a to a previous tacky coat and I still see the scratches and the road "rash" mini chips.

Is it going to turn invisible and sit into it properly once it cures fully or did I F something up in the prep phase or it's just the carbon weave that is scratched? I'm about to do a third tacky coat now and let it cure and level it with some 180 grit then probably do 2 other coats.

Warren (Staff) - 5/15/2020 1:31:41 PM
You would need to sand through the chips.  The cracks you need to be careful not to sand through the carbon pattern - if you remove the pattern, the area will look black under the resin rather than show the weave. 

Hey I'm in a learning phase so I figured why not. I went over an area that had a white blemish like that and I think I sanded through the carbon? It is white and light shines through it but still feels like the epoxy around. 

Could you confirm what happened here? I'm in a learning phase so I don't mind and it's a good way for me to learn.

Based from what I know now, I think that is just a layer of fiberglass that is sitting under the carbon?



So with that in mind, all the other white knicks we see is most likely impacts that tore off the carbon?
